Why Phoenix Is a Strong Market for Vehicle Transport


Phoenix supports a high volume of car shipments because it is a major population center with strong regional connections. The city attracts new residents, seasonal travelers, and people relocating across state lines. Consequently, carriers often move through the area on a regular basis. The road network around Phoenix also helps support vehicle relocation services. Major highways create efficient access to nearby states and other large cities. Even so, not every pickup point is equally simple. Some neighborhoods, apartment complexes, and private streets may be difficult for large transport trailers to enter comfortably.


Climate and season can affect transport conditions as well. While Arizona avoids some weather delays seen elsewhere, extreme heat still influences planning and timing. Moreover, certain times of year bring higher transport demand from snowbirds and long-distance movers. Because of that, prices and scheduling can shift more than some customers expect.


Phoenix also sees a wide range of vehicle shipping needs. Standard sedans, family SUVs, pickup trucks, and specialty vehicles all move through this market. Therefore, service should be matched carefully to the vehicle being transported. What works for a daily driver may not be the best option for a classic or luxury car.


What Affects Price and Service Quality


Several factors shape the cost of moving a vehicle to or from Phoenix. Distance matters, yet it is only one part of the full picture. A shorter route with difficult pickup access may cost more per mile than a longer, high-demand corridor. Consequently, the route itself often matters just as much as total mileage.


Vehicle size and condition can also influence the quote. Larger vehicles take more trailer space and add extra weight, which can raise the cost. If a vehicle is inoperable, loading may require more equipment and more time. In those cases, the transport plan becomes more complex, and pricing should reflect that clearly.


Timing is another major factor. Urgent pickup requests often cost more because schedules must be adjusted quickly. On the other hand, flexible timing can create more carrier options and sometimes lower rates. For this reason, customers who plan earlier often receive a more balanced shipping estimate and smoother coordination.


Service type deserves attention too. Open transport is common and practical for standard vehicles, while enclosed transport offers additional protection from weather and road exposure. That extra protection usually comes with a higher price. Still, many owners choose it for rare, classic, or high-value cars because the added care feels worthwhile.


A strong quote should also reflect current auto transport rates without feeling vague or misleading. If an estimate seems too low, it may not reflect the actual market. Therefore, realistic pricing usually provides more value than a tempting number that changes later. Honest quotes tend to support better customer experiences overall.


Common Mistakes People Make Before Booking


One common mistake is choosing only by price. Although budget matters, the lowest quote is not always the smartest option. A cheaper estimate may involve broader pickup windows, weaker communication, or less convenient arrangements. As a result, what seems affordable at first can create frustration later.


Another mistake is providing incomplete shipment details. If the vehicle size, condition, or pickup location is described incorrectly, the estimate may not remain accurate. Later changes can affect both scheduling and cost. Accurate information from the beginning usually leads to a more dependable car transport experience.


Many customers also wait too long before arranging service. Last-minute bookings often reduce carrier availability, especially during busy relocation periods. Phoenix remains an active market, yet demand can still tighten when many people need transport at once. Planning ahead usually gives customers more flexibility and a better chance of securing suitable dates.


Pickup and delivery access is often overlooked as well. Large carriers cannot always enter tight residential streets, parking garages, or gated communities easily. If that issue is not discussed early, confusion can develop on shipping day. Experienced transport providers usually explain these route realities before the vehicle is scheduled.


Some customers also assume every quote includes the same service level. In reality, one estimate may include better communication, more practical scheduling, or a smoother handoff process. Those differences can shape the experience from start to finish. That is why it is so important to read beyond the final price.
